Warning Signs You Need Desiccant Dehumidification

Ignoring moisture damage can lead to costly repairs down the line. Here are some common warning signs that show you need Desiccant Dehumidification: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of moisture damage. If you’ve tried to remove the smell with cleaning products or air fresheners, but it persists, it’s likely a sign of a more serious issue.

Water Stains or Warping on Walls or Floors

Visible water stains or warping on walls or floors can show that moisture is seeping into your property. This can lead to structural damage and costly repairs if left unchecked.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old and mildew can grow rapidly in damp environments, posing serious health risks to you and your family. If you notice black spots or patches on walls, ceilings, or floors, it’s time to call in the experts.

Unpleasant Humidity or Condensation

Excessive humidity or condensation can make your home feel uncomfortable and even unhealthy. If you notice that your home is consistently damp or humid, it may be a sign of a more serious issue.

Water Damage or Leaks

Leaks or water damage can be a sign of a more serious issue, such as a roof leak or plumbing problem. If you notice water damage or leaks,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Desiccant Dehumidification Cost in Lexington, OH

The cost of Desiccant Dehumidification can vary widely depending on the severity of the moisture dam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the area. Our prices are competitive and based on the specific needs of your property. Here’s a rough estimate of what you might expect to pay: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Small water spill or leak $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of materials involved
Large water damage or flood $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Musty odors or mold growth $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of mold or mildew
Water stains or warping on walls or floors $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area, type of materials involved
Unpleasant humidity or condensation $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Water damage or leaks $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area

Keep in mind that these are rough estimates, and the actual cost of Desiccant Dehumidification may be higher or lower depending on your specific situation. We offer free estimates and consultations to help you understand the costs involved.
